Linux Trigger:如何使用Git进行版本控制
导读:使用Git进行版本控制是软件开发中的一项基本技能。以下是一些基本的步骤和命令,帮助你开始使用Git: 1. 安装Git 首先,你需要在你的系统上安装Git。根据你的操作系统,安装方法会有所不同。 在Linux上: sudo apt-ge...
使用Git进行版本控制是软件开发中的一项基本技能。以下是一些基本的步骤和命令,帮助你开始使用Git:
1. 安装Git
首先,你需要在你的系统上安装Git。根据你的操作系统,安装方法会有所不同。
-
在Linux上:
sudo apt-get update sudo apt-get install git -
在macOS上:
brew install git -
在Windows上: 你可以从Git官网下载并安装Git。
2. 初始化一个新的Git仓库
在你的项目目录中,运行以下命令来初始化一个新的Git仓库:
git init
3. 配置Git
设置你的用户名和电子邮件地址,这些信息将用于你的提交:
git config --global user.name "Your Name"
git config --global user.email "your.email@example.com"
4. 添加文件到暂存区
将文件添加到暂存区,准备进行提交:
git add <
file>
# 添加单个文件
git add . # 添加所有文件
5. 提交更改
将暂存区的更改提交到仓库:
git commit -m "Initial commit"
6. 查看状态和历史记录
查看当前仓库的状态和提交历史:
git status
git log
7. 分支管理
创建、切换和管理分支:
git branch <
branch-name>
# 创建新分支
git checkout <
branch-name>
# 切换分支
git merge <
branch-name>
# 合并分支
8. 远程仓库
将本地仓库与远程仓库关联,并进行推送和拉取操作:
git remote add origin <
repository-url>
git push -u origin master # 推送到远程仓库的master分支
git pull origin master # 从远程仓库拉取最新更改
9. 克隆仓库
如果你需要克隆一个现有的Git仓库:
git clone <
repository-url>
10. 解决冲突
在合并分支或拉取远程更改时,可能会遇到冲突。你需要手动解决这些冲突,然后再次提交:
# 手动编辑冲突文件
git add <
resolved-file>
git commit -m "Resolve merge conflict"
11. 标签管理
为重要的提交打标签,便于版本管理:
git tag <
tag-name>
<
commit-id>
git push origin <
tag-name>
12. 撤销更改
如果你需要撤销某些更改,可以使用以下命令:
git checkout -- <
file>
# 撤销工作区的更改
git reset <
file>
# 撤销暂存区的更改
git revert <
commit-id>
# 撤销某个提交的更改
通过这些基本步骤和命令,你应该能够开始使用Git进行版本控制。随着你对Git的进一步学习,你会掌握更多高级功能和技巧。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: Linux Trigger:如何使用Git进行版本控制
本文地址: https://pptw.com/jishu/778184.html
